Learn keyfacts about Certificate in Observed Teaching Practice course requirements
- The Certificate in Observed Teaching Practice course requires participants to complete a minimum of 10 hours of observed teaching practice.
- Participants will receive feedback and guidance from experienced instructors to enhance their teaching skills.
- The course focuses on developing effective teaching strategies, classroom management techniques, and student engagement methods.
- Upon completion, participants will demonstrate improved teaching abilities and confidence in delivering engaging and impactful lessons.
- The course is designed for educators, trainers, and anyone looking to enhance their teaching skills in various educational settings.
- Participants will have the opportunity to practice teaching in a supportive and constructive environment.
- The course emphasizes practical application and hands-on experience to ensure participants are well-prepared for real-world teaching scenarios.
